Key Insights
The European bio-medical waste management market, valued at €22.05 billion in 2025, is projected to experience robust growth, driven by a compound annual growth rate (CAGR) of 4.61% from 2025 to 2033. This expansion is fueled by several key factors. Stringent regulations concerning the safe disposal of infectious and hazardous medical waste are enforcing the adoption of advanced waste management technologies across hospitals, clinics, and research facilities. The increasing prevalence of chronic diseases and an aging population contribute to a larger volume of medical waste generated, necessitating efficient and compliant disposal solutions. Furthermore, rising awareness among healthcare providers regarding the environmental and public health risks associated with improper bio-medical waste management is driving the demand for specialized services and technologies. Major players, including SUEZ Group, Veolia Environmental Services, and Remondis Medison, are actively investing in research and development to offer innovative solutions, further propelling market growth.
The market segmentation reveals significant opportunities within specialized waste treatment technologies, such as incineration, autoclaving, and chemical disinfection. Geographical variations in regulatory frameworks and waste generation patterns lead to diverse market dynamics across European nations. While Western European countries have well-established waste management infrastructures, Eastern European nations present a high growth potential due to ongoing infrastructural developments and increasing regulatory scrutiny. Competitive pressures are shaping the market landscape, with industry giants focusing on mergers, acquisitions, and strategic partnerships to expand their market share and service offerings. Key Developments in Europe Bio-Medical Waste Management Market Industry
- June 2024: Waste Management Inc. acquired Stericycle for USD 7.2 Billion, expanding its presence in medical waste management.
- September 2023: LabCycle launched a pilot plant for recycling up to 60% of plastic lab waste, showcasing innovation in waste recycling.
- January 2023: Bertin Medical Waste's Sterilwave solution received UNIDO recognition for its innovative and responsible approach to medical waste treatment.

8. Can you provide examples of recent developments in the market?
June 2024: Waste Management Inc. and Stericycle confirmed a definitive agreement, with Waste Management acquiring all outstanding shares of Stericycle at USD 62.00 per share in cash. This deal, totaling approximately USD 7.2 billion, accounts for Stericycle's net debt of around USD 1.4 billion. With this acquisition, Waste Management is expected to broaden its environmental solutions portfolio by incorporating Stericycle's prominent assets in the lucrative medical waste and secure information destruction industries.
